The toolkit focuses on the social, academic and financial aspects of the move into further and higher education

BBC News NI South East ReporterIn addition to a new course in a new place, the move often comes with a fresh wave of freedoms, temptations and challenges.

It focuses on the social, academic and financial aspects of the move into further and higher education, and also directs young people towards relevant supports.Launching the initiative was All-Ireland winning GAA footballer Oisín McConville who has spoken openly about the effect problem gambling had on his younger years."A lot of what they hear is focused on education, exams, results and choices of further education," he said.

The impact social media has had on younger generations has created a sentiment that previous mistakes can stay with a young person in the long term."A lot of it is lost [the right to make mistakes] and that if you make one mistake it will stay with you for the rest of your life," he explained.
